Master the Art of Layering
Layering is the secret weapon of winter fashion. Instead of piling on bulky garments, choose thin, well-fitted layers that trap heat without overwhelming your silhouette. Start with a snug base layer like a thermal or silk undershirt to keep you warm from within. Over that, wear a sleek sweater or turtleneck in neutral shades such as gray, black, or beige. Finally, top it off with a well-tailored coat or jacket that allows for comfortable movement while accentuating your shape.

Choose Fabrics That Love the Cold
The fabrics you choose play a huge role in both your comfort and style during winter. Embrace materials that are as luxurious as they are functional:
- Wool: Breathable and moisture-wicking, wool is perfect for outer layers and adds a classic touch to your look.
- Cashmere: Known for its softness and lightweight warmth, cashmere is ideal for scarves and sweaters. Look for blends that include silk or merino wool for extra smoothness.
- Down: Modern down jackets and coats are designed to provide exceptional warmth without the bulky appearance. Opt for styles with a cinched waist or belt to keep your silhouette defined.

Step Up Your Shoe Game
Winter footwear is where practicality meets style. The right pair of boots can tie your entire look together:
- Knee-High or Ankle Boots: A polished pair in smooth leather with rubber soles offers both elegance and grip on slippery surfaces.
- Insulated Options: For extremely cold days, choose boots with proper insulation that keep your feet warm without appearing too bulky.
- Heeled Boots: Not only do they provide extra elevation, but they also add a touch of sophistication to your outfit.
